Curitiba (CWB) to São Roque (JHF) Flight Distance

The flight distance from Afonso Pena Airport (CWB) in Curitiba, Brazil to São Paulo Catarina Executive Airport (JHF) in São Roque, Brazil is 310 kilometers (192 miles / 167 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 1h, flying northeast at a heading of 41°.

This is a short regional route, typically operated by turboprop or small regional jet aircraft. Flight time is minimal and passengers can expect a quick, efficient journey.

This is a domestic route within Brazil. Both airports operate in the same country, which may simplify travel requirements and documentation.
